06 2017 档案

摘要:Android 中传参数的时候经常需要传参数,有时候参数需要通过bundle进行传递,但每次都要写如下显得非常麻烦 所以我就写了个工具类中使用的方法,只需传参数就可以了,方法暂时只支持String,int,boolean,实现接口的Serializable和Parcelable,欢迎使用这个方法 使 阅读全文
posted @ 2017-06-26 16:28 一只呆萌的萌呆 阅读(201) 评论(0) 推荐(0) 编辑
摘要:首先介绍下这个开源项目,这个开源项目是BiliBli 开源的,首先感谢他们的团队。 这是开源的地址: https://github.com/Bilibili/ijkplayer 首先我为什么要选这个,因为公司需要做视频类的功能,所以我就找了 Vitamio和ijkplayer 他们的口碑最好,后来查 阅读全文
posted @ 2017-06-23 15:26 一只呆萌的萌呆 阅读(9266) 评论(0) 推荐(3) 编辑
摘要:转自:Android View中getViewTreeObserver().addOnGlobalLayoutListener() 我们知道在oncreate中View.getWidth和View.getHeight无法获得一个view的高度和宽度,这是因为View组件布局要在onResume回调后 阅读全文
posted @ 2017-06-21 15:26 一只呆萌的萌呆 阅读(801) 评论(0) 推荐(0) 编辑
摘要:网址:http://www.jcodecraeer.com/a/opensource/2015/0121/2338.html 介绍: rebound是facebook的开源动画库。可以认为这个动画库是独立于android Framework之外的一种动画实现。 运行效果: 使用说明: Rebound 阅读全文
posted @ 2017-06-21 13:54 一只呆萌的萌呆 阅读(1615) 评论(0) 推荐(0) 编辑
摘要:转自:打造一个高逼格的android开源项目 小引子 在平时的开发过程中,我们经常会查阅很多的资料,最常参考的是 github 的开源项目。通常在项目的主页面能看到项目的简介和基本使用,并且时不时能看到页面汇中有好多的彩色标签,看起来很酷,很专业,很有逼格,能提升很多的好感度。 前言 本文又是一篇很 阅读全文
posted @ 2017-06-20 14:11 一只呆萌的萌呆 阅读(1594) 评论(0) 推荐(0) 编辑
摘要:转载自:CardView的具体使用方法 因为学习做此记录方便查找使用 今天主要是CardView的用法,CardView是在安卓5.0提出的卡片式控件。首先介绍一下它的配置。 在gradle文件下添加依赖库: 其次介绍一下它的基本属性: app:cardBackgroundColor这是设置背景颜色 阅读全文
posted @ 2017-06-19 14:06 一只呆萌的萌呆 阅读(4073) 评论(0) 推荐(0) 编辑
摘要:转载:http://www.open-open.com/lib/view/open1496585426285.html 使用方法:http://www.see-source.com/androidwidget/detail.html?wid=1362 前言 Banner广告位是APP 中的一个非常重 阅读全文
posted @ 2017-06-16 15:23 一只呆萌的萌呆 阅读(755) 评论(0) 推荐(0) 编辑
摘要:效果: 阅读全文
posted @ 2017-06-15 00:05 一只呆萌的萌呆 阅读(718) 评论(0) 推荐(0) 编辑
摘要:首先放网址(建议挂个vpn): maven库中心:http://search.maven.org/ jcenter库中心:https://bintray.com/bintray/jcenter 接下来我们来操作看下: 1.第一步我们得知道自己得知道要查什么。 例如我们在这里查查 我们复制下 com. 阅读全文
posted @ 2017-06-13 15:29 一只呆萌的萌呆 阅读(762) 评论(0) 推荐(0) 编辑
摘要:今天看见viewpager还有个这个方法决定记下来 博客介绍: ViewPager限定预加载的页面个数setOffscreenPageLimit(int limit) 如果你的viewpager中有6个页面,你不想进去快速滑动时看到loading的页面就设置预加载全部一次加载完吧,至于为什么是快速滑 阅读全文
posted @ 2017-06-13 10:08 一只呆萌的萌呆 阅读(131) 评论(0) 推荐(0) 编辑
摘要:一般我们在项目中的gradle会添加如下库文件 所以每次升级的时候都要修改后面的23.1.0版本号,Android开发小组的Chris Banes想出了这样的一个方法,不用每次修改每个版本,而只需要修改一次就行了,如下 但是有个注意点: 上面这种写法不对 这种写法才是正确的 (就是把单引号换成了双引 阅读全文
posted @ 2017-06-12 10:13 一只呆萌的萌呆 阅读(1345) 评论(0) 推荐(0) 编辑
摘要:标题栏 TitleBar:https://github.com/FlyJingFish/TitleBar 可擦除带动画的ImageView:https://github.com/FlyJingFish/EraseImageView 自定义ShapeImageView:https://github.c 阅读全文
posted @ 2017-06-12 10:08 一只呆萌的萌呆 阅读(901) 评论(1) 推荐(0) 编辑
摘要:说起内存泄漏还是挺让人头疼的,而且不是每个手机都会发生的情况,往往又不易察觉,那么今天我们就来介绍下LeakCanary这个工具 githup: https://github.com/square/leakcanary 这里能获取最新的版本 中文文档:https://www.liaohuqiu.ne 阅读全文
posted @ 2017-06-12 09:47 一只呆萌的萌呆 阅读(357) 评论(0) 推荐(0) 编辑
摘要:转自:RecyclerView Bug:IndexOutOfBoundsException: Inconsistency detected. Invalid view holder adapter的解决方案 RecyclerView是Android-support-v7-21版本中新增的一个Widg 阅读全文
posted @ 2017-06-09 12:58 一只呆萌的萌呆 阅读(883) 评论(0) 推荐(0) 编辑
摘要:githup中找到:https://github.com/yescpu/KeyboardChangeListener KeyboardChangeListener simple and powerful Keyboard show/hidden change listener,without hav 阅读全文
posted @ 2017-06-09 09:59 一只呆萌的萌呆 阅读(2383) 评论(0) 推荐(0) 编辑
摘要:在应用中有时会遇到,例如你listView 的设置的高度为warp_content 自适应,listView下方有个TextView但如果你删了一个listView的item 我们希望下面的TextView能自己顶上来,就是网上移一个item的高度,依然贴在listView最下方,但是往往TextV 阅读全文
posted @ 2017-06-05 18:02 一只呆萌的萌呆 阅读(1792) 评论(0) 推荐(0) 编辑

点击右上角即可分享
微信分享提示